Popeye’s proposed for Sunrise Highway location in Bohemia

|

A Popeye’s Louisiana Chicken may soon open in Bohemia.

On Feb. 9, the Town of Islip Planning Board reviewed an application for a fast food eatery at 4525 Sunrise Highway. The existing site plan calls for a 2,145-square-foot Popeye’s Louisiana Kitchen with a 46-seat dining room and a drive-thru window.

Based on the plan, the drive-through will wrap from the parking lot to the rear of the building to accommodate at least a dozen cars.

The applicant, under the name Bohemia Chicken, LLC, requested a change of zone from a business 2 district to a business 3 district. It also requested a special permit from the town board to permit a fast food restaurant.

The site along Sunrise Highway is currently barren and neighbors a 7-Eleven. During the meeting, Sean Colgan, the town’s senior planner, said “a nearly identical application for a fast food restaurant was applied for in 2018, but was withdrawn after the public hearing.”

Members of the public who spoke during the meeting voiced concerns over excessive noise that may travel northward from the fast food joint to the residential area.

The planning board closed the hearing and asked the applicants to review and address concerns raised during the hearing. Among these concerns, the applicant will explore sound attenuation methods with the town.

A representative for the application said the restaurant would operate from 10:30 a.m.-11:30 p.m. six days a week, and that it would likely have reduced hours on Sundays.
